cargo-nidus 1.0.2

Command-line project generator and inspection tooling for Nidus applications.
mod support;

use std::{fs, process::Command};

use support::{temp_project_root, workspace_root};

#[test]
fn cargo_nidus_check_validates_project_structure() {
    let root = temp_project_root("check_validates_project_structure");
    let project = root.join("hello-nidus");
    let status = Command::new(env!("CARGO_BIN_EXE_cargo-nidus"))
        .args(["nidus", "new", "hello-nidus", "--path"])
        .arg(&root)
        .arg("--nidus-path")
        .arg(workspace_root().join("crates/nidus"))
        .status()
        .unwrap();
    assert!(status.success());

    let valid = Command::new(env!("CARGO_BIN_EXE_cargo-nidus"))
        .args(["nidus", "check", "--path"])
        .arg(&project)
        .output()
        .unwrap();
    assert!(valid.status.success());
    assert!(
        String::from_utf8(valid.stdout)
            .unwrap()
            .contains("Nidus project check passed")
    );

    let invalid = Command::new(env!("CARGO_BIN_EXE_cargo-nidus"))
        .args(["nidus", "check", "--path"])
        .arg(root.join("missing"))
        .output()
        .unwrap();
    assert!(!invalid.status.success());
    let stderr = String::from_utf8(invalid.stderr).unwrap();
    assert!(stderr.contains("Cargo.toml"));
}
